Flood cleanup services involve the thorough removal of water from properties affected by flooding, whether from heavy rain, burst pipes, or other water intrusion events. These professionals utilize specialized equipment to extract standing water, dry out affected areas, and prevent further damage. The process often includes cleaning and disinfecting surfaces to reduce the risk of mold growth and other health hazards. Prompt and effective flood cleanup can help minimize structural damage and restore a property to its pre-flood condition.

Many problems arise when water infiltrates a home or commercial building, such as warped flooring, stained walls, and compromised insulation. Excess moisture can also lead to mold growth, which can pose health risks and require costly remediation. Flood cleanup services are designed to address these issues quickly, removing water and moisture before they cause long-term damage. By addressing both visible water and hidden moisture, these services help protect the integrity of the property and promote a healthier indoor environment.

The overview below groups typical Flood Cleanup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Norwalk, CT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or flood cleanup projects in Norwalk, CT, range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s involving localized water removal and surface drying fall within this band. Fewer projects reach the higher end, which is reserved for more extensive work.

Moderate Damage Restoration - For moderate flooding that requires water extraction, drying, and some structural repairs,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this range involve multiple rooms or partial rebuilds, while larger jobs are less common.

Extensive Flood Damage - Larger, more complex flood cleanup jobs can cost from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. These involve significant structural repairs, mold remediation, and comprehensive drying processes, with fewer projects reaching this level.

Full Replacement - Complete replacement of flooring, drywall, and other materials after severe flooding can exceed $10,000, depending on the scope. Such extensive projects are less frequent but may be necessary in cases of severe damage or long-term flooding issues.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
